Summary:In order to study the influence of molecular structure features on their supramolecular organization in the floating layers and thin films 15 new meso-substituted tetraphenylporphine derivatives and their metal complexes with substitution in para- or ortho-positions (-OC 4 H 9 or -OC 16 H 33 ) were investigated. Methods full-scale modeling of supramolecular organization of the compounds in the floating layers was performed using molecular mechanics and molecular dynamics. The dependence of supra-molecular organization of floating layers and thin films from the structure of the porphines was studied.
